Transaction 6955990b0d924bb788ecbbf4cc08029202f14a82b2b5970bb568266a4a0872c6
1 Input
1 Output
-
6955990b0d924bb788ecbbf4cc08029202f14a82b2b5970bb568266a4a0872c6:0
- value
- 15999596
- script pubkey
- OP_0 OP_PUSHBYTES_20 d3185bf14854e1bc1b40b38a7813b6cf701e6a4a
- address
- bc1q6vv9hu2g2nsmcx6qkw98syakeacpu6j20yyrpl